Frequently Asked Questions

What kind of accuracy can be expected from the Geissele GFR in 6mm ARC?

The Geissele GFR demonstrated impressive accuracy, achieving an initial 0.41 MOA group during zeroing. Subsequent tests showed groups around 1.12 inches unsuppressed and tightened to 0.89 inches when suppressed, indicating consistent sub-MOA potential.

What are the benefits of the Geissele GFR's cold hammer-forged barrel?

Geissele's cold hammer-forged, chrome-lined barrels provide significantly better longevity and durability compared to stainless steel barrels. This manufacturing process also maintains high levels of accuracy, making it a practical choice for demanding use.

How does the 6mm ARC cartridge perform in the Geissele GFR?

The 6mm ARC cartridge is well-suited for the Geissele GFR, offering superior ballistics out to 1,000 yards compared to 5.56 NATO. It provides a capable option for long-range shooting within the AR-15 platform.

Does adding a suppressor affect the accuracy of the Geissele GFR?

Yes, testing showed that adding a suppressor tightened the groups on the Geissele GFR from approximately 1.12 inches to 0.89 inches. This aligns with observations that suppressors can often improve the harmonic stability and accuracy of AR-15 style rifles.
